The St. Malo Warriors welcomed the Lundar Falcons to St. Malo on Friday night.
Things started well for St. Malo when Teagan Fillion (Cure) scored to make it a 1-0 game going into the second.
Lundar got on the board early when Braeden Lukas (Russell, Johanesson) would tie it up.
St. Malo would answer with two of their own when Seb Frechette (Freynet, Preteau) and Ashton Dubois scored to make it 3-1 Warriors.
Lundar would answer right back with two goals of their own thanks to Dylan Vitelli (McGreedy, Mantik) and Ryan Benson (MacMillan).
St. Malo we're able to grab the lead back before the third period when Keston Worley (Fillion, Fillion) riffled one to make it 4-3 heading to the third.
In the third St. Malo would get their second two goal lead of the game thanks to Jeremie Collette (Dubois) to make it 5-3.
Lundar would add a late goal to close it out at 5-4 Warriors.
St. Malo is back in-action Sunday afternoon in Beausejour for a match up between the top two teams in the CRJHL standings.
